How to Build a Profitable Sportsbook


A sportsbook is a gambling establishment where people place bets on sports events. In most countries, it is illegal to operate a sportsbook without a license. To avoid losing money, sportsbook operators must make sure that their operations are secure and comply with all regulations. This may require them to install age verification and self-exclusion programs and carry out regular audits. These efforts can be time-consuming and costly, but they are necessary for the success of a sportsbook.

To attract more customers, sportsbook operators should offer a variety of payment options. This includes credit and debit cards, e-wallets, and even cryptocurrency payments like Bitcoin. By using multiple payment methods, sportsbooks can build a more robust customer base and increase profits. They should also ensure that their registration process is simple and easy for users to complete. This means providing a form that is not too long or asking for irrelevant information. Moreover, they should offer fast processing times and maintain the privacy of users.

In order to maximize profits, it is important for sportsbook operators to understand the rules of each game. This can help them create better betting lines and odds. In addition, they should always keep track of their bets in a spreadsheet. This will help them monitor their results and identify potential problem areas. It is also advisable to stick with sports that they are familiar with from a rules perspective and to follow news related to players and coaches. This will enable them to recognize potentially mispriced lines.

Another way to improve sportsbook profitability is to offer a layoff account. This feature is designed to balance bets on both sides of the point spread and minimize financial risk. It is an essential tool for any sportsbook owner, and it can be found in many leading online sportsbooks.

One of the most common mistakes that sportsbook owners make is ignoring their user base. This is a mistake because if your product isn’t engaging, people will not come back for more. To avoid this mistake, you should create an app that has a slick UI and provides users with the features they want.

It is also a good idea to include filtering options in your sportsbook. This will allow users to quickly find the teams and games that they are interested in and improve their overall experience with your service. It is also a good idea to provide a live scoreboard and statistics so that your users can stay up-to-date on the latest action.

Running a sportsbook is a complicated task that requires careful planning and a strong foundation. Although building a sportsbook from scratch is possible, it will require a sizable time and resource commitment. For most companies, buying a turnkey solution is more practical. However, there are several drawbacks to this option. For one, white label solutions are difficult to decouple from and can limit your flexibility. In addition, they can add a significant amount to your costs and may eat into profit margins.